What We’re Watching - 1/23/25

With so much going on, it is understandable for people to feel news whiplash. To help our partners stay focused and find the signal in the noise, we are happy to share what we are tracking:

  • Pardoning the January 6 insurrectionists – including those who committed intentional violence – sends a message that lawless behavior will be excused as long as it serves the interest of the President.

  • Instructing prosecutors to not enforce a law forcing the sale of TikTok – a law passed with bipartisan support in Congress and unanimously upheld by the Supreme Court – shows a troubling disregard for checks and balances.

  • Issuing an executive order ending birthright citizenship, a principle enshrined in the U.S. Constitution, undermines the authority of the Constitution and unduly creating chaos for those with legal rights to citizenship.
